L9 0HH is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on Cornett Road, 0.6km from Warbreck Park in Liverpool. Administratively it sits within Fazakerley ward and the Liverpool, Walton constituency.
For families considering a move, L9 0HH represents a terrace-heavy neighbourhood — tight-knit community, affordable housing. During the day, mainly white, agricultural workforce, on the edges of smaller towns. A balanced community with an average age of 37 — families, professionals, and long-term residents all well represented. 78% of properties are owner-occupied — a strong indicator of neighbourhood stability and long-term community investment.
Safety: Crime is moderate at 53 incidents per 1,000 residents — broadly typical for this type of urban area. Property: With prices averaging £132k, this is one of the more affordable postcodes in the area, up 20.8% year-on-year.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.
Census 2021 statistics for L9 0HH are sourced from Output Area E00034392 (shared with 5 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
